ROLE OF YOGASANA IN PREGNANCY
Veena A. Patil, *Sakshi Sachan, N. B. Swami, Bhagyashri Khot and Priyanka Sankpal
ABSTRACT
Yoga is spiritual science i.e. mind body binding practice encompasses a system of Asan, pranayama and meditation. A mother nurture and carries a baby for nine long months and hopes that the baby comes in the world as healthy. Prenatal yoga shows a lot of benefit in pregnant women who suffer from depression, stress, low back pain and lack of sleep. It is absolutely necessary for pregnant women to maintain her physical and mental health both for her own sake and sake of the child. Number of studies shows that yogasan during pregnancy improves high risk pregnancy. An integrated approach towards yogasan during pregnancy is that it is safe and leads to improve outcome such as for improving birth weight, decrease intrauterine growth retardation either in isolation or associated with pregnancy induced hypertension with no increased complications. Largely achievable health of a baby is depends on the mother diet and physical activity. Yogasan encourage the normal labour and decreases the rate of caesarean section.
